Curriculum-Based Assessments are used to test which of the following?

Explanation:
Curriculum-based assessments focus on measuring what students have learned from the specific material taught in class. They’re closely aligned with unit goals and standards, so teachers can see whether students are mastering the content and skills planned for that curriculum, and use the results to guide instruction. These assessments aren’t designed to gauge general intelligence, school climate, or attendance, which relate to other aspects of schooling rather than the taught content.
